Challenges We Faced
Creating an infinite, seamless hexagonal world without performance drops.
Designing logic-driven tiles that interact dynamically with player actions.
Managing real-time terrain updates and procedural rendering efficiently.
Ensuring worlds adapt to both height maps and runtime generation.
Balancing performance optimization with high visual fidelity.
Solution We Propose
We engineered a framework that balances runtime speed, scalability, and extensibility — ensuring smooth gameplay while supporting infinite procedural growth
Built a real-time procedural world generator optimized for runtime performance.
Enabled infinite scaling while keeping terrain transitions seamless.
Developed a tile-based logic system for interactive gameplay mechanics.
Integrated height-map support for customizable world generation.
Designed with modular scalability, allowing expansion for multiple biomes and environments.
Height Map + Runtime Blend: Seamlessly blend user height maps with procedural noise for natural-looking variation without losing authored intent.
